Embroidered Birthday Onesie

by Smockity Frocks on August 2, 2008

I think this sweet little embroidered birthday onesie turned out well. MaddieLynn drew the cupcake for me and I traced it onto the onesie. (Click on the photo to enlarge.)

I embroidered the design and added the rick rack on the sleeves. Super simple!

At first, I thought I would attach the tutu, but I couldn’t figure out how to get it to look just right, so I decided to leave it as a separate piece that will tie in back. I used pretty ribbon and a yard of tulle.
